2. Traditional Rajasthani Art
Some brides dream of a royal wedding look, and Rajasthani mehndi gives just that. These designs are full of culture and beauty with portraits, elephants, and fine details. The cooler weather makes it easier to sit through longer sessions, too. 3. Simple Arabic Style
If you’re a bride who likes to keep things simple yet stylish, Arabic mehndi might be the perfect fit. With flowing shapes, spaced floral work, and a modern touch, it’s easy to wear and quick to apply. Arabic designs are great for winter weddings because they dry quickly and still look beautiful. 4. Glove-Inspired and Net Designs
One of our most requested winter looks this year is glove-style mehndi. These designs create a net or lace effect on your hands, like wearing delicate gloves. It’s a fresh take that goes really well with velvet bridal outfits or gowns. If you’re a bride who loves fashion but wants to keep a traditional vibe too, this style offers the best of both worlds—and it photographs beautifully in close-up shots.
5. Personal Story Designs
Some brides want their mehndi to tell a story. Personalized designs include things like your initials, the proposal, or even small drawings of something meaningful to your relationship. Winter weddings are perfect for these because there's more time to sit for the detailed work. Final Tips for Winter Brides
Winter weddings are beautiful, but they come with a few things to keep in mind. Make sure you apply mehndi in a warm space so the design dries well. Wear something comfortable with loose sleeves, and avoid using lotion before your session.
